LPS Hard coat corrosion inhibitor is dark brown in color and provides multi-year protection for metal parts in outside storage. The liquid corrosion inhibitor has a vapor pressure of 2.60 millimeters Hg at 20 degrees C and has 0.514 VOC contents that evaporate without leaving any residues or stains. It has a flash point of 107.6 degrees F and a specific gravity of 0.87 to 0.89 at 20 degrees C. This product has a boiling point of 320 degrees F and a viscosity less than 20.5 square millimeters per second at 40 degrees C. The corrosion inhibitor has a cherry odor and comes in a 1-gallon can. It withstands a temperature range of -40 to 175 degrees F.Features:Ready-to-use corrosion inhibitor is safe to use on plastics and paintsCan be applied with conventional airless or air-operated spray equipmentProduces durable, hard and translucent filmResists dripping and puddling during spray applicationVapor density of 4.8Provides 1500+ hours of salt spray resistance on aluminumPenetrates to displace water and then forms a durable, transparent filmRequires curing time of 24 hoursBenefits:Designed for use on sides and tops of aircraft fuselagesProvides cone shaped mist spray patternApplications:Aircraft fuselagesBare metalCargo sectionsMetal parts and machineryOverseas storage or shipmentsSpecifications:Boeing BMS 3-23F Type IIBombardier (Canadair) CMS 565-06 Type I, Bombardier DeHavilland DHMS C4.12 Type II Grade 3Delta AirlinesLockheed Martin Heavy Duty CPC 3aPolar Air Cargo
